(%s?)\n", numstr); return 1; } if (endp[0] != '%') { parse_error("RH values must end in %%\n"); parse_error("\tExample: column h2o RH 45%%\n"); return 1; } *val = x; return 0; } /* get_RH_value() */ /*********************************************************** * static void init_freq_grid(model_t *model) * * Purpose: * initialize the frequency and squared frequency arrays. * * Arguments: * model_t *model - pointer to model structure * * Return: * 0 if OK * 1 on error ************************************************************/ static void init_freq_grid(model_t *model) { double f0; gridsize_t i; /* * The frequency grid is aligned to the origin. That is, it * consists of all points i * df, where i is an integer, on the * closed interval f_min <= f <= f_max. This alignment is * required for computation of delay spectra by discrete Hilbert * transformation. It also facilitates caching of absorption * coefficients to disk, since all grids with the same df are * aligned to one another. */ f0 = model->df * ceil((model->fmin * (1.0 - DBL_EPSILON)) / model->df); for (i = 0; i < model->ngrid; ++i) { model->f[i] = f0 + (double)i * model->df; model->f2[i] = model->f[i] * model->f[i]; } return; } /* init_freq_grid() */ /*********************************************************** * static int is_numeric_token(const char *tok) * * Purpose: * Checks a token *tok to see if it looks like a number, by * attempting to convert it to a double. * * Arguments: * double *tok - token to be checked * * Return: * 1 if tok is a number * 0 otherwise ************************************************************/ static int is_numeric_token(const char *tok) { double x; char *endp; if (tok == NULL || tok[0] == '\0') return 0; x = strtod(tok, &endp); if (!(x == x)) return 0; /* NaN is not a number */ if (endp[0] != '\0') return 0; else return 1; } /* is_numeric_token() */ /*********************************************************** * static void list_allowed_units(const int ugroup) * * Purpose: * For use in error messages, prints a list of allowed * units belonging to the unit group ugroup. * * Arguments: * const int ugroup - unit group number ************************************************************/ static void list_allowed_units(const int ugroup) { int i, nchar = 0; for (i = 0; i < UNIT_END_OF_TABLE; ++i) { if (unit_tab[i].group == ugroup) { if (nchar > 40) { fprintf(stderr, "\n"); nchar = 0; } if (nchar == 0) parse_error("\t"); else nchar += fprintf(stderr, " "); nchar += fprintf(stderr, "%s", unit_tab[i].name); } } fprintf(stderr, "\n"); return; } /* list_allowed_units() */ /*********************************************************** * static int load_fit_file_list( * const char *file_list, * fit_data_t *fit_data) * * Purpose: * loads the list of fit data file names into the fit data * structure. * * Arguments: * char *file_list - * string containing path to list of fit data files * fit_data_t *fit_data - fit data structure * * Return: * 0 on success, 1 otherwise ************************************************************/ static int load_fit_file_list( const char *file_list, fit_data_t *fit_data) { char nbuf[AM_MAX_FNAMESIZE - AM_FIT_EXTSIZE]; char **tptr; int i; FILE *fp; if ((fp = fopen(file_list, "r")) == NULL) return FILELIST_CANNOT_OPEN; while (fgets(nbuf, (int)sizeof(nbuf), fp) != NULL) { ++fit_data->nfiles; if ((tptr = (char**)realloc(fit_data->filename, fit_data->nfiles * sizeof(char*))) == NULL) { errlog(33, 0); return FILELIST_ERROR; } fit_data->filename = tptr; if ((fit_data->filename[fit_data->nfiles - 1] = (char*)malloc((1 + strlen(nbuf)) * sizeof(char))) == NULL) { errlog(33, 0); return FILELIST_ERROR; } /* * Chop any whitespace off the end of the input line (including * CR and LF). */ i = (int)strlen(nbuf) - 1; while (isspace(nbuf[i])) nbuf[i--] = '\0'; strcpy(fit_data->filename[fit_data->nfiles - 1], nbuf); } return FILELIST_OK; } /* load_fit_file_list() */ /*********************************************************** * static int parse_config_line(char *buf, int argc, char **argv, char **tok) * * Purpose: * Breaks a configuration line into tokens, according to * the following rules: * - Quoted strings become a single token, sans quotes. * - Tokens beginning with a comment character are ignored, * along with the rest of the line. * - Tokens such as %1, %2,... are replaceable parameters, * and are replaced with argv[2], argv[3],... * - No replacements are made in quoted strings, such as * format strings and quoted filenames. * * Arguments: * char *buf - line buffer * int argc - command line argument count * char **argv - command line argument list * char **tok - array to receive tokens * * Return: * Number of tokens found, or MAX_NTOK if there are too * many tokens. * * Negative values are returned for errors involving * replaceable paramters. model->df = df; model->df_unitnum = get_unitnum(tok[6]); /* * Bypass remaining frequency grid range checks and length * computations if we're in atmospheric model only (-a) mode. * This prevents checking for frequency grid errors when it * doesn't matter, so the user can just do * * f 0 GHz 0 GHz 0 GHz * * for example. In -a mode, it's also OK to have no * frequency grid statement at all, but if a grid was defined * in the original config file, we do want to preserve it for * the stderr output. */ if (output[ALL_OUTPUTS].flags & OUTPUT_AM_ONLY) return KWFUNC_SUCCESS; /* * Frequency grid range checks */ if (f_max < f_min) { parse_error("The frequency grid appears to be out of order.\n"); return KWFUNC_SYNTAX_ERROR_CONTINUE; } if (df <= DBL_EPSILON * (f_max - f_min)) { parse_error("The frequency grid interval is too small.\n"); return KWFUNC_SYNTAX_ERROR_CONTINUE; } if ((f_max - AM_MAX_FREQ) > (DBL_EPSILON * AM_MAX_FREQ)) { parse_error("The maximum grid frequency is %g GHz, which is the\n", AM_MAX_FREQ); parse_error("\tupper limit of am's internal spectroscopic data.\n"); return KWFUNC_SYNTAX_ERROR_CONTINUE; } /* * Calculate the size of the frequency grid, and the padded * array sizes for Fourier and Hilbert transforms. Note that * the frequency grid is aligned to the origin; it consists * of all points i * df, where i is an integer, on the closed * interval fmin <= f <= fmax. * * There are two limits on the size of the frequency grid; * these limits also apply to the padded grids, but will only * matter if padded arrays are actually needed. * * (1) Arrays are indexed with a signed integer of type * gridsize_t, defined in am_types.h. For compatibility with * OpenMP's parallel loop construct, which requires a signed * integral loop index, gridsize_t is of signed integral * type. Normally, gridsize_t will be a 32-bit int in both * 32- and 64-bit environments. * * (2) The number of bytes in an array cannot exceed the * maximum signed long int. Note that this is a factor of 2 * smaller than the maximum pointer size on practically any * machine. The reason for the more restrictive limit is * that fseek(), which is used to read arrays cached to disk, * uses a signed long int for the file offset. * * In 32-bit environments, (2) will set the upper limit on * array size. In 64-bit environments (except Win64, which * has 32-bit longs), (1) will be the limit if gridsize_t is * defined to be a 32-bit int. */ gridsize_t_limit = (double)GRIDSIZE_T_MAX; fseek_limit = (double)LONG_MAX / (double)sizeof(double); dbl_imin = ceil((f_min * (1.0 - DBL_EPSILON)) / df); dbl_imax = floor((f_max * (1.0 + DBL_EPSILON)) / df); gridsize = 1.0 + dbl_imax - dbl_imin; if (gridsize > gridsize_t_limit || gridsize > fseek_limit) { parse_error("The defined frequency grid has too many points.\n"); return KWFUNC_SYNTAX_ERROR_CONTINUE; } model->ngrid = (gridsize_t)(gridsize + 0.5); if (model->ngrid < 1) { parse_error("The defined frequency grid contains no points.\n"); return KWFUNC_SYNTAX_ERROR_CONTINUE; } /* * model->npad is the padded array size for convolution of * spectra with an instrumental line shape. It is the * smallest power of 2 which is at least three times the * model frequency grid size. See ils.c for more details on * the array layouts. If the array size would be too large, * signal this by setting model->npad to zero. This won't * generate an error unless an ils is defined. */ (void)frexp(3.0 * (double)model->ngrid, &n); gridsize = ldexp(1.0, n); if (gridsize > gridsize_t_limit || gridsize > fseek_limit) { model->npad = 0; } else { model->npad = 1 << n; } /* * model->Lpad is the padded array size for the Hilbert * transform to compute the delay spectrum. It is the * smallest power of 2 which can hold the two-sided spectrum * (including any internal zero padding from -f_min to f_min, * if f_min != 0) further zero- padded by a factor of 4. If * the array size would be too large, set model->Lpad to * zero. This won't generate an error unless L is going to * be computed. */ (void)frexp(dbl_imax, &n); n += 3; gridsize = ldexp(1.0, n); if (gridsize > gridsize_t_limit || gridsize > fseek_limit) { model->nLpad = 0;
